SUNNYVALE, USA: Fortinet announced that the company has been awarded an ADVANCED+ rating in AV-Comparative's July 2013 Anti-Phishing Test, earning a 97 percent score out of 100 percent.

AV-Comparatives staff tested Fortinet's anti-phishing capabilities along with 15 other endpoint security solutions from multiple countries for phishing URL detection and false positives.

The awards presented included ADVANCED +, ADVANCED, STANDARD and no award. STANDARD winners are considered to be good products that achieved a "good" score, ADVANCED winners received a "very good" score and ADVANCED+ winners received an "excellent" score.

Products that did not receive an award may still require further improvement to reach the tested goal. An overview of past awards can be found on the company's website. For the July 2013 test, malware sets were frozen on July 21, 2012 and consisted of 187 samples.

Fortinet's anti-phishing technology is part of the suite of security services developed and maintained by the company's global FortiGuard Labs research team, which delivers industry-leading advanced malware threat protection for a wide range of Fortinet products, including FortiGate, FortiWeb, FortiMail, FortiCarrier, FortiCache and FortiClient products. The technology is also found at the heart of Fortinet's FortiOS 5.
